What Are The Qualities Of A Good VP Talent Development?

Now let’s talk about some qualities that a good VP talent development should have. It is important to have the good qualities of a VP talent development. 

This is because having these qualities will make the company very successful. Moreover, the people working in the company will be happy and satisfied with this job holder. 

The following are some of the qualities of a good VP talent development. Firstly, a good VP talent development should have problem-solving skills. 

This is because he will need to solve problems that might occur in the company. Secondly, a good VP talent development should have effective leadership skills. 

This is because he will have to motivate his employees and encourage them to work hard. Lastly, a good VP talent development should have good communication skills. 

This is because he will have to communicate with the management of the company. And also with the employees of the company. 

Moreover, he will have to communicate with customers of the company too. 

What Qualifications Do We Need To Be A VP Talent Development?

 Now let’s talk about what qualifications you need to be a VP of talent development to do this job well. Firstly, you need to have an MBA degree in human resources or business administration.

Furthermore, you need to have an advanced degree in business administration or human resources management. Lastly, you should know how to solve business problems and how to motivate employees at all times. 

Moreover, you should be able to make sure that your company is profitable at all times.
